Output 7c6ab2c644430e3c8276960d603c6749233e1709e885b37d750f59faad3a57f5:0

value
1480504942
script pubkey
OP_0 OP_PUSHBYTES_20 8ab069159e82faa9fec140223fb5b16c7f8cb1a3
address
bc1q32cxj9v7sta2nlkpgq3rldd3d3lcevdrs26qz0
transaction
7c6ab2c644430e3c8276960d603c6749233e1709e885b37d750f59faad3a57f5
confirmations
319044
spent
true